WebThe figure presents the molecular structure of water and ammonia as well as the interactions of these two molecules. The water molecule has two H atoms bonded with an O atom, which also has 2 pairs of nonbonding electrons. The ammonia molecule has three H atoms bonded with an N atom that also has 1 pair of nonbonding electrons. WebAug 31, 2024 · Figure 10.19. 1 The insolubility of nonpolar molecules in water. Even if it were possible to mix nonpolar molecules (shown in gray) and water molecules as shown in (a), this situation would be unstable. The water molecules would soon congregate together under the influence of their dipole and hydrogen-bonding attractions, attaining the ... WebStructure of Ice. Liquid water is a fluid. The hydrogen bonds in liquid water constantly break and reform as the water molecules tumble past one another. As water cools, its molecular motion slows and the molecules move gradually closer to one another.
